Hi,

I've been trying to install the trial version of FrameMaker 9 on Vista  Home Premium, but as soon as I start the installer, I get the following  error message:



I then get Select Setup Language dialog box, but the drop-down list is  empty. I do have a BootstrapperConfig.xml file in the Installer  Resources folder, and the installer does work on my XP machine. I  couldn't find any report of such an error anywhere. Note that, oddly, the XML file looks like a binary file...

Does anybody have an idea?

    We did find a solution for our problem, but this was on a company PC with AD company policies. When all company policies was removed before installing, everything went perfectly

    It is a bad solution to remove policies, but I did work, and maybe I will give you an idea on what to look for in your situation
